Commonalities in Near-Death Experiences
Numerous near-death experiences (NDEs) exhibit shared characteristics across cultures and religious backgrounds, indicating a universal experience. Researcher studies highlight that over 900 scholarly articles support the idea of NDEs being a genuine phenomenon rather than mere hallucinations. Common threads among these experiences include the sensation of leaving the physical body, encountering a bright light, and meeting deceased loved ones or spiritual figures. These observations suggest that a consistent, underlying reality exists beyond individual interpretations or cultural differences.
